As the decade of disco brought in countless unique Chicago voices, Tom Washington and Charles Stepney continued to innovate together with multifaceted, inspired song arrangements. Chicago is an American rock band formed in 1967 in Chicago, Illinois.The self-described 'rock and roll band with horns' began as a politically charged, sometimes experimental, rock band and later moved to a predominantly softer sound, generating several hit ballads.The group had a steady stream of hits throughout the 1970s and 1980s.
